Cancellation Policy
As you plan your RiNo Art District walking tour, it’s important to familiarize yourself with the cancellation policy in case any unforeseen circumstances arise.
The refund policy for the tour is straightforward. If you cancel your reservation up to 24 hours in advance, you’ll receive a full refund. However, if you cancel less than 24 hours before the start time, no refund will be provided. It’s important to note that changes made less than 24 hours before the start time aren’t accepted.
Plus, if the tour doesn’t meet the minimum number of travelers required, you’ll have the option to receive a refund or reschedule. This ensures that you have flexibility in case the tour doesn’t reach the minimum capacity.
